update devilspie to 0.21

maintainer time-out
This commit is contained in:
jasper 2007-11-21 11:48:37 +00:00
parent bfadd0bf18
commit 0d0d41b8bf
4 changed files with 24 additions and 32 deletions

View File

@ -1,9 +1,8 @@
# $OpenBSD: Makefile,v 1.8 2007/09/15 20:04:19 merdely Exp $
# $OpenBSD: Makefile,v 1.9 2007/11/21 11:48:37 jasper Exp $
COMMENT= window manipulation tool
DISTNAME= devilspie-0.19
PKGNAME= ${DISTNAME}p0
DISTNAME= devilspie-0.21
CATEGORIES= x11
HOMEPAGE= http://www.burtonini.com/blog/computers/devilspie
@ -16,10 +15,11 @@ PERMIT_PACKAGE_FTP= Yes
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
WANTLIB= X11 Xext Xrender cairo atk-1.0 c fontconfig freetype m z \
gdk_pixbuf-2.0 gdk-x11-2.0 glib-2.0 glitz png \
gmodule-2.0 gobject-2.0 gtk-x11-2.0 \
pango-1.0 pangoft2-1.0 pangocairo-1.0
WANTLIB= X11 Xau Xcomposite Xcursor Xdamage Xdmcp Xext Xfixes \
Xi Xinerama Xrandr Xrender atk-1.0 c cairo expat fontconfig \
freetype gdk-x11-2.0 gdk_pixbuf-2.0 glib-2.0 glitz \
gmodule-2.0 gobject-2.0 gtk-x11-2.0 m pango-1.0 pangocairo-1.0 \
pangoft2-1.0 png startup-notification-1 z
MASTER_SITES= http://www.burtonini.com/computing/

View File

@ -1,5 +1,5 @@
MD5 (devilspie-0.19.tar.gz) = NfVVAAtCbiE4SrKCxkxpdQ==
RMD160 (devilspie-0.19.tar.gz) = XtcnX4hHex/PnpiEKBOVA0HjS8E=
SHA1 (devilspie-0.19.tar.gz) = jjsfKTSmxdLictGn03wg3zJmKP4=
SHA256 (devilspie-0.19.tar.gz) = Pz+OPfXbiKS7dMAyXk5Qk/fKL5rG/BaoXueFbX8y/sI=
SIZE (devilspie-0.19.tar.gz) = 155947
MD5 (devilspie-0.21.tar.gz) = pa4Ysxkgkq/mRc/MTsKvoQ==
RMD160 (devilspie-0.21.tar.gz) = XlDcH6qaC7LIllsXko65mVq9p34=
SHA1 (devilspie-0.21.tar.gz) = 1FyoX/2iZk3I76TcCJt3dkhYPEU=
SHA256 (devilspie-0.21.tar.gz) = wfyi+NMEXI/TsGMxlRdiTNP0a/bwB0N8BrsMkOrn29o=
SIZE (devilspie-0.21.tar.gz) = 192445

View File

@ -1,20 +0,0 @@
$OpenBSD: patch-src_actions_c,v 1.1 2006/09/22 00:43:03 pvalchev Exp $
--- src/actions.c.orig Thu Sep 21 17:45:15 2006
+++ src/actions.c Thu Sep 21 17:45:42 2006
@@ -138,14 +138,14 @@ ESExpResult *func_center(ESExp *f, int a
gint xoffset, yoffset, window_width, window_height,
workspace_width, workspace_height;
int new_xoffset, new_yoffset;
+ WnckScreen *screen;
+ WnckWorkspace *workspace;
/* read in window geometry */
wnck_window_get_geometry (c->window,
&xoffset, &yoffset, &window_width, &window_height);
/* read in workspace geometry */
- WnckScreen *screen;
- WnckWorkspace *workspace;
screen = wnck_window_get_screen (c->window);
workspace = wnck_screen_get_active_workspace (screen);
workspace_width = wnck_workspace_get_width (workspace);

View File

@ -0,0 +1,12 @@
$OpenBSD: patch-src_xutils_h,v 1.1 2007/11/21 11:48:37 jasper Exp $
--- src/xutils.h.orig Mon Nov 19 07:41:22 2007
+++ src/xutils.h Mon Nov 19 07:41:24 2007
@@ -28,6 +28,8 @@
#include "libwnck/window.h"
+#define WNCK_WINDOW_MODAL_DIALOG 127 /* XXX */
+
G_BEGIN_DECLS
Atom my_wnck_atom_get (const char *atom_name);